Why Audio-Video Sync Matters for Video Podcasts
In video podcasting, audience retention hinges on seamless production quality. One of the most common—and most jarring—defects is a misalignment between audio and video. When a guest’s lip movements lag behind the spoken word or when background sounds shift out of place, viewers immediately disengage. Sync errors signal amateurism and can undermine even the most compelling content. Professional video podcasters treat synchronization as a non-negotiable technical foundation, as critical as lighting or microphone choice.
Sync problems typically fall into two categories: static offset (a constant delay from the start) and drift (a gradual timing shift that worsens over time). Static offset usually stems from recording into separate devices that capture audio and video at different start points. Drift arises from mismatched sample rates, frame rates, or clock sources. Understanding the root cause helps select the right correction method. Modern editing software offers both manual waveform alignment and automated sync tools, but knowing when and how to apply each technique separates a polished podcast from a frustrating one.
Choosing the Right Editing Software for Sync Workflows
Your choice of editing platform will define your sync workflow. Every major NLE (Non-Linear Editor) provides built-in tools for aligning audio and video, but their efficiency and automation level vary. Below is a breakdown of popular options and how they handle sync for video podcasts.
Adobe Premiere Pro
Premiere Pro’s Merge Clips feature (multicamera source sequence) lets you synchronize clips based on audio waveforms, timecode, or markers. It’s particularly effective for podcasters who record multiple cameras and a separate audio track. The software also supports third-party plug-ins like PluralEyes for automatic sync across devices. Premiere’s audio waveform rendering is highly accurate, and its timeline is responsive enough for fine manual adjustments. The main drawback is the subscription cost, but the workflow speed often justifies the expense for regular producers.
DaVinci Resolve
DaVinci Resolve (free version included) offers robust sync capabilities in the Cut and Edit pages. Use the Auto Sync Audio function—simply select your video clips and the separate audio file, then choose “Based on Waveform” from the sync menu. Resolve handles drift correction well for longer recordings. It also supports multi-camera editing with sync via timecode or audio. The learning curve is steeper than Premiere, but the price point (free for most features) makes it ideal for budget-conscious creators. Final Cut Pro
For macOS users, Final Cut Pro includes a synchronized clips workflow that automatically aligns audio and video when you drag them into the timeline. You can also create a multicam clip that syncs via timecode, markers, or audio. The magnetic timeline makes slipping clips effortless. Final Cut’s automatic sync is fast and reliable for most podcast scenarios, though it struggles with severe drift if the recording exceeds 90 minutes without a sync point.
Shotcut and HitFilm Express
Free alternatives like Shotcut and HitFilm Express offer basic manual sync—aligning waveforms by eye on the timeline. They lack one-click automatic sync, but for podcasters willing to invest a few extra minutes, the results can be acceptable. These tools are best suited for single-camera recordings with a clean clap sync point.
Step-by-Step Syncing Workflow for Video Podcasts
The following systematic approach will help you sync audio and video consistently, whether you use professional or free software. The steps assume you have recorded a separate audio track (e.g., via a USB mixer or portable recorder) and a video feed from your camera or phone.
1. Pre-Recording Preparation
Sync success begins before you hit record. Establish a clear sync point at the start of every recording session:
- Use a clapperboard or slate: The visual and audible cue from a clapboard creates a spike in both the video’s audio track (if the camera records built-in audio) and your separate audio recorder. Aligning this spike is the fastest manual sync method.
- Record a sync track on the camera: Even if you plan to replace the camera audio with a high-quality external recording, leave the camera mic running. The scratch audio gives you a waveform that matches the external recorder’s waveform, making sync possible later.
- Generate timecode: If your devices support it, jam-sync timecode before the shoot. Timecode-locked recordings can auto-sync in post with zero manual alignment.
- Record a minute of room tone: Before the podcast begins, capture 30–60 seconds of ambient sound. Room tone helps in diagnosing drift and can be used for noise reduction later.
2. Import and Organize Media
Create a dedicated project folder for each episode. Import all video files and the high-quality audio file (WAV or FLAC recommended) into your editing software. If you recorded multiple cameras, label them clearly (e.g., Cam1_Host, Cam2_Guest). In Premiere or Resolve, you can group clips that belong to the same take before syncing.
3. Manual Waveform Sync (The Reliable Fallback)
Even with automatic tools, knowing manual sync is essential. Place your video clip on one track and the external audio on another. Zoom in on the timeline so you can see the waveforms clearly. Find a distinct, sharp transient—often the clap from the slate or the first word spoken. Align the peaks of the external audio with the corresponding peak in the camera’s scratch audio track. Slide the audio clip (or video clip) until the transents match. Play back at 50% speed to verify lip-sync accuracy. A sync error of fewer than two video frames (about 1/30 of a second for 30fps) is imperceptible to most viewers.
4. Automatic Sync with Software Tools
Most modern NLEs provide automatic sync features that save time:
- Premiere Pro: Select both clips, right-click, and choose “Merge Clips.” In the dialog, select “Audio” as the sync point. Premiere will analyze waveforms and align them.
- DaVinci Resolve: In the Cut page, select the video and audio clips, right-click, and choose “Auto Sync Audio” → “Based on Waveform.” Resolve handles drift compensation.
- Final Cut Pro: Drag both clips into the timeline, select them, and choose “Synchronize Clips” from the Clip menu. FCP creates a compound clip that stays in sync even when trimmed.
If you work with many cameras, consider dedicated sync software like PluralEyes. It can sync unlimited tracks and automatically handles drift, frame rate mismatches, and even syncs GoPro clips with professional audio. PluralEyes works as a standalone app or as a plug-in for Premiere and Final Cut.
5. Fine-Tune and Lock
After automatic sync, always preview at normal speed and at 200% zoom on a talking head section. Look for any slip. If you see a persistent misalignment (e.g., the audio is consistently 3 frames ahead), nudge the track using the arrow keys (usually one frame per press). Once satisfied, select the synchronized group and lock the tracks (track header lock icon) to prevent accidental movement during editing. Some editors recommend converting the synced clips into a multicamera sequence for easier scene cutting.
Common Sync Pitfalls and How to Avoid Them
Even with careful workflows, certain issues repeatedly trip up podcasters. Being aware of these pitfalls will save you time in post-production.
Drift Over Long Recordings
If a podcast runs 90 minutes or longer, audio and video may slowly drift apart due to clock inaccuracies. The camera and audio recorder might have slightly different internal clocks. Solution: After a manual sync at the start, add a second sync point around the 45-minute mark. In your NLE, split the audio track at that point and realign the second half to the video. Better yet, use a software that supports drift correction (like PluralEyes or a robust waveform-based sync in Resolve).
Mismatched Sample Rates
Recording audio at 48 kHz on the camera but 44.1 kHz on the external recorder causes a pitch and timing discrepancy. Always record all audio at the same sample rate (48 kHz is standard for video). If you inherit mismatched files, convert the external audio to 48 kHz before importing (using Audacity or your NLE’s audio converter).
Variable Frame Rate (VFR) from Smartphones
Smartphones often record in variable frame rate to save storage. VFR wreaks havoc on sync because the number of frames per second changes during the clip. Convert any smartphone footage to constant frame rate (CFR) using a tool like HandBrake or the HandBrake official website before bringing it into your NLE. Alternatively, use editing software that handles VFR gracefully (e.g., DaVinci Resolve with the free project setting to interpret VFR as CFR).
Audio Latency from Wireless Microphones
Wireless mics and digital transmitters can introduce a slight delay (often 10–20 ms). This delay may not be obvious on a single camera, but when you sync multiple cameras, the wireless mic’s audio may appear early or late compared to the camera’s internal mic. The fix: sync using the camera’s scratch audio as the reference, then mute the scratch audio after alignment and use the external track. Some NLEs allow you to nudge individual audio clips by milliseconds.
Advanced Techniques for Multi-Camera Podcasts
If your podcast uses two or more cameras, sync becomes more complex but manageable with the right methods.
Using Timecode
Professional productions rent or buy timecode generators (e.g., Tentacle Sync, Atomos) to jam-sync all cameras and audio recorders. After importing, you can automatically sync clips in Premiere or Resolve using the embedded timecode. This reduces manual work to zero and eliminates drift. For podcasters on a budget, the Tentacle Sync E system is cost-effective and widely recommended.
Multicamera Workflow
Once clips are synced (either manually or with timecode), group them into a multicamera source clip. In Premiere, select all synced clips and choose “Create Multicamera Source Sequence.” Then edit by switching camera angles in real time while the timeline plays. The sync remains locked throughout. DaVinci Resolve’s Cut page offers a similar “Multicam” function.
Syncing Podcast Videos with Separate Audio Tracks per Mic
A common configuration: each speaker uses their own microphone, recorded into a multitrack audio interface. You’ll have a stereo or multi-channel WAV file plus one video clip (or multiple videos). Sync one audio track (e.g., host’s mic) to the video using waveform. Then, after sync, the other audio tracks will be perfectly aligned because they were recorded simultaneously. This makes multitrack editing for separate speaker levels possible without re-syncing.
